About This Item

Cupples and Leon. Used - Good. 1908. Cupples and Leon. Cloth, 12mo, 332 pp, frontis. First U.S. printing. Some scuffing and spotting to boards, circular stain at rear, light bumping to corners. Modest rubbing to joints. Spine sunned a bit, and has a very small gouge. Pages clean and binding solid. Overall, a Good to Very Good copy. (Subject: Literature.)
